Demands from labor union 'huge burden' on company, says Kakao's management
Kakao Corp. said Friday a compensation package demanded by its union could place a huge burden on the company's operations, after workers said they would proceed with a strike next month. The official statement came after Kakao's management and its labor union failed to reach an agreement in the second round of negotiations mediated by the government.
